A tier-one car-parts maker will mass-produce the gearboxes humanoid robots need, starting 2027

Schaeffler said on 21 August it has finished validation testing on formed strain wave gearboxes built specifically for humanoid robots and will manufacture them at scale from 2027.

What it means for your work

Humanoid pricing has been held up by hand-built actuators; an established supplier committing a production line to them is what moves the cost curve.
